Types of hairdressing scissors
Hairdressing scissors vary in design and function and are considered essential shaving tools . The following are the most prominent types:
- Thinning scissors : These have small teeth on one or both blades and help to thin out hair, especially used for styling thick hair or when you want to thin out the edges.
- Edge Scissors : Similar to thinning scissors but designed to add volume to hair and precisely cut ends to give hair a more vibrant look.
- Straight scissors : Featuring straight blades, they are an ideal choice for creating clean, precise lines in haircuts.
- Long hair scissors : They feature long blades and are used to cut long hair, ensuring accuracy and saving time.
- Small, precision scissors : used for fine details such as cutting hair around the ears or trimming the beard and mustache.
- Traditional barber scissors : This is one of the most common types of barber scissors, and is used for regular cutting and precise length determination. It is characterized by its sharp blades and simple design, which makes it ideal for daily use.

The difference between barber scissors and hairdressing scissors
The difference between barber scissors and hairdressing scissors lies in the size and length of the scissors. Barber scissors are known to be heavier than the other types because they are made of steel and men's hair is usually coarser; therefore, barber scissors should be strong, durable and sharp. Hairdressing scissors are lighter in weight and have a finer blade so that the blade can glide through the hair and make the cut with ease.
